    Held a 1.5 hour birthday party for a group of 2-5 year olds here on a Saturday morning on the…read morerecommendation of a staff member at our child care center. Lazy Daisy staff was helpful, patient, and kind! Party room was spacious and cheery, and not fancy, so no worries about what young kids might do in the space. Plenty of tables and chairs for a group of 10 kids plus parents--had two sets of tables so we could do ceramics on one, have extra activities (paper crowns to decorate, coloring pads, blank cards, fossil excavation kit) on the other for those who finished painting early, and then could have cake at the first table once the ceramics were cleared away. They let us store our ice cream cake from Kirt's in their freezer till it was time, and even helped us find plates and forks, which we forgot to pack. (Fortunately there is a nearby gas station with sundries.) They are a small business, so cash/check is preferred (wish I had remembered to bring a checkbook). We did a "test run" painting some small items in the drop-in studio with the two birthday celebrants a week before the party, which worked well so they felt familiar with the venue and activity--if you can manage it I'd recommend that too. In theory the room can handle up to 50, but I'd say our group of ~25 was perfect for the space. Would warmly recommend this place to any parents seeking alternatives to Little Gym, Carver Rec, and Discovery Museum birthday parties for this age group!
